I am curious as to the orientation of the parts being painted, to the airbrush. Are the sides of the car perpendicular to the airbrush? Holding the body on a paint stand would result in the sides of the body getting the paint applied straight onto the surface. Holding the body the same way might result in the paint being applied on an angle. I now hold the body with the upper surface tipped toward me so that the paint hits the surface directly instead of at an angle. Sometimes small things can make big differences. What is going on with my Airbrush.
Bill Eh? replied to Mike 1017's topic in Model Building Questions and Answers
Installing the replacement TAL-8 to get it to effectively seal against the needle is a trial and error process. Installing it too tight will cause this new needle packing to fail again sooner than it should. Once initially installed, hold your airbrush vertically with the nozzle end pointing up. Then take your needle, with the non business end barely inside the airbrush body, and let the needle drop. If it falls right through the airbrush, then the needle packing is not tight enough and doing its job. Tighten the needle packing a little more, think about 1/8th of a turn. Try the needle drop again. Keep repeating this process until the needle does not fall through. When it gets "held" by the needle packing, then the needle packing is doing its job and is adjusted correctly / tight enough. -
What is going on with my Airbrush.
Bill Eh? replied to Mike 1017's topic in Model Building Questions and Answers
Usually if you experience bubbling in the cup it might be one of two things. The nozzle is experiencing a leak where it joins with the airbrush body. If the nozzle has a seal (o-ring) attached, you might just need to replace the o-ring. If there is no seal on the nozzle, some bees wax on the nozzle threads will seal it. If the nozzle is damaged (think cracked or chipped), you will need to replace it. As said before, the air and paint are finding the path of least resistance. With the evidence of paint getting back to the trigger mechanism, that would indicate to me that the needle packing (TAL-8) needs to be tightened or replaced. Tightening is not that difficult if you have a small slot blade screwdriver. Some needle packings are a brass fitting which compresses a separate ptfe o-ring (or other material). Others are an integral unit with o-ring attached to brass fitting. -

Tamiya spray cans banned in Canada!!!
Bill Eh? replied to Bullybeef's topic in General Automotive Talk (Trucks and Cars)
I just received an email back from Borgfeldt. Borgfeldt Info 12:18 PM (48 minutes ago) Hi Bill, Thank-you for your email. Unfortunately, we have received notice from Environment Canada that some of the paints include a chemical with too high of a concentration to import without a permit. As such we have removed all of the Tamiya Aerosols and some other items from sale. We are working with our suppliers on clarifying SDS across the colours individually and potential formula changes to meet Canadian regulations. We should have more updates soon once we receive the final documents from Environment Canada and news from our suppliers. Meanwhile, the retail stores can still sell any inventory they have but we cannot re-stock them. Customer service -
